Olivia Colman is now an Emmy winner! The 47-year-old English actress won for the second season of her acclaimed performance as Queen Elizabeth II in the Netflix historical drama, “The Crown.” After losing to Zendaya last year, Colman beat out co-star Emma Corrin as well as Uza Aduba (“In Treatment”), Jurnee Smollett (“Lovecraft Country”), Mj Rodriguez (“Pose”) and Elisabeth Moss (“The Handmaid’s Tale”) for Outstanding Lead Actress in a Drama Series, in what was one of awards’ most competitive categories of the night.
Colman was visibly shocked at her win. “I would have put money on that not happening,” she said. “I want to say thank you very much for this, this is amazing.
